Understanding the DTF Printing Process
DTF printing, or Direct-to-Film printing, is a revolutionary method that simplifies the transfer of vibrant designs onto various fabrics. The process begins with creating a digital design, which is then printed onto a specialized PET film using a DTF printer. This printing method allows for intricate designs with rich colors, as the printer utilizes both colored and white inks. The white ink layer not only enhances the brightness of the colors but also provides a solid base for deeper hues on darker fabrics, ensuring clarity and vibrancy in the final product.
After the design is printed, the next crucial step involves applying a layer of hot melt adhesive powder onto the wet ink. This step is essential as it helps to firmly adhere the design to the fabric during the heat transfer phase. Using a heat press, the film and fabric are hot-pressed together, causing the adhesive to activate and bind the design to the garment securely. The entire process showcases DTF printing’s ability to deliver high-quality results, making it a popular choice among custom garment printers.
The Advantages of DTF Printing
One of the standout advantages of DTF printing is its unmatched versatility. Unlike traditional printing methods that often require pre-treatment of fabrics, DTF allows for designs to be effectively transferred onto a wide range of materials, including cotton, polyester, and even blends. This flexibility supports creative expression, enabling designers to cater to diverse customer preferences without limitations.
Moreover, DTF printing excels in producing high-quality designs that stand the test of time. The vibrant colors and intricate details achieved through this process are not only visually appealing but also durable. Customers can enjoy their custom garments without worrying about fading or peeling after multiple washes, making DTF printing a reliable choice for both businesses and consumers alike.

The Essential Equipment for DTF Printing
Investing in the right equipment is essential for achieving optimal results in DTF printing. The cornerstone of this process is a DTF printer that is specifically designed to work with DTF inks. These printers are tailored to handle the unique demands of printing on PET film, ensuring vibrant and durable print quality.
Furthermore, high-quality PET film is crucial for successful transfers. It acts as the medium upon which designs are printed, and using inferior materials can lead to poor adhesion and faded prints. Additionally, a reliable heat press machine is necessary to apply even pressure and heat, allowing for a seamless transfer of designs onto the fabric. Each piece of equipment plays a vital role in ensuring the overall success of the DTF printing process.
Best Practices for DTF Printing
To maximize the potential of DTF printing, practitioners should adhere to a few best practices. Start by ensuring that all equipment is properly calibrated and maintained; this includes checking the printer settings and regularly replacing inks and other consumables as needed. It’s also advisable to conduct test prints before committing to larger batches to ensure that the color accuracy and quality meet desired standards.
Additionally, proper design preparation plays a critical role in the success of DTF printing. Utilize high-resolution images and vector graphics whenever possible, as this enhances the clarity and quality of the final print. Attention to detail during the design phase can significantly reduce errors and enhance the overall aesthetic of the finished product.

How does DTF printing compare to traditional screen printing methods?
DTF printing differs from traditional screen printing in that it does not require screen setups or extensive preparation for different colors. DTF offers more flexibility, allowing for vibrant, high-resolution prints on a variety of fabrics, while screen printing may require more complex processes, especially for intricate designs.
